I have a computer which is password protected. There are some folders which I want to share with everyone on workplace network.
I want password protection for certain folders, and no password protection for other public folders. And now I want to password protect some shared folder, and allow some colleagues to read and print the contents, but can't modify and copy, some colleagues can't even read. At the same time, my boss and superiors can have full right. Is it possible, and how to set it? |
